The ***Jira admin*** can define which Jira groups can **create reports **in the add-on or just **view the reports **created with the add-on and what **time tracking information **will be accessible to the users in Jira groups.

## How to access permissions?

- From the top navigation bar, click on **Administration → Access Permissions **to land on the tab shown below

## Access Permissions Overview

- The page lists **all the Jira groups **in user’s Jira instance. For each group, the Jira admin can determine access for
  - **Creating Reports**: If unchecked, users in the group will not be able to create reports or access the add-on but will be able to see the reports shared with them via dashboards
  - **Reporting Time for other users**: If unchecked, users in the group will be able to see only Personal Time Tracking information while creating Timesheet Report (only ‘Logged in User’ time)
- If a user belongs to multiple groups and different permissions are set on the groups then the group which has the highest access defined will be considered as that user’s access
- Click '**Save**' at the bottom on the page to save the settings
